Job Summary

As a Market Vice President at Visual Edge IT, you'll lead and inspire a high‑performing sales organization focused on driving growth through new business development, account expansion, and strategic partnerships. This is a leadership role for a dynamic, results‑driven professional who thrives on developing talent, executing business strategy, and delivering measurable results. You will play a pivotal role in setting vision, driving execution, and ensuring that your market achieves consistent revenue and profitability growth across Visual Edge IT's portfolio of managed IT services, hardware, and professional solutions.

Roles and Responsibilities
  • Lead, coach, and develop a team of Branch Managers and Account Executives to achieve market growth, profitability, and customer satisfaction goals.
  • Build and execute a comprehensive sales strategy that aligns with company objectives and drives expansion across all product and service lines.
  • Establish clear performance expectations, metrics, and accountability frameworks to ensure consistent achievement of targets.
  • Foster a culture of consultative, customer‑focused selling that prioritizes long‑term partnerships and solution‑based outcomes.
  • Identify new business opportunities and market trends; develop go‑to‑market strategies to expand Visual Edge IT's footprint.
  • Oversee budgeting, forecasting, and performance analysis to ensure accurate projections and effective market resource allocation.
  • Collaborate with internal departments—operations, service, marketing, and finance—to deliver a seamless customer experience.
  • Recruit, train, and retain top sales talent, ensuring team readiness and scalability for future growth.
  • Drive continuous improvement through coaching, data‑driven decision‑making, and process optimization.
  • Represent Visual Edge IT's values and brand through community engagement, networking, and executive‑level client relationships.
  • Lead with integrity, accountability, and action—championing the IAACT values that define our culture.
Required Skills / Experience
  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Sales,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.
  • 8+ years of progressive sales leadership experience, including at least 5 years managing multi‑level sales teams.
  • Proven success leading strategic sales initiatives that drive double‑digit growth and market share expansion.
  • Deep understanding of B2B solution selling, including managed IT services, cybersecurity, hardware, and workflow solutions.
  • Strong business acumen with experience in budgeting, forecasting, P&L management, and sales analytics.
  • Skilled at building and executing sales plans, managing complex pipelines, and driving accountability at all levels.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ills with the ability to motivate and influence cross‑functional teams.
  • Proficiency with CRM and reporting tools such as Salesforce, ConnectWise, and BrightGauge.
  • Exceptional ability to foster client relationships, anticipate market shifts, and adapt strategy accordingly.
  • Demonstrated commitment to developing people, building strong teams, and cultivating a performance‑driven culture.

401(k)

Visual Edge gives employees access to a 401k program and offers an employer match benefit. Visual Edge IT will match 100% of an employee's contribution up to the first 3% and will provide an additional 50% match on the next 2% of the employee contribution.
